How does a dry barrel fire hydrant drain

How does a dry barrel fire hydrant work? Dry barrel hydrants are pressurized and drained through the workings of a main valve located in the base of the hydrant. When the main valve is closed, the drain valve automatically opens, draining all water from the barrel of the hydrant. When the hydrant is opened, the drain valve automatically closes.

A dry hydrant, or dry fire hydrant, is typically an unpressurized and permanently installed pipe with one end below the water level of a pond with a strainer to prevent debris from entering the pipe. When necessary, a fire engine can pump from your pond by drafting water. Dry Barrel Hydrant. Dry Barrel Hydrant type
